Can you mix oil paints and vegetable oil and will it still dry properly?

ummm....yes, well...petroleum products are not actually part of fine oils. The pigments are ground in one or more of several seed oils that will catalize and harden when exposed to oxygen. Vegetable cooking oils will not harden with oxidation, but will merely become gummy. So...the upshot is....automotive lubricants and oil paints are unrelated (!!??) and you can't use crisco to paint with either.
